The Madrid City Council is launching an ambitious project to preserve and enhance the Quinta de la Fuente del Berro Park, a Cultural Heritage site with over five centuries of history. The master plan includes the restoration of the Rafael Altamira Cultural Center – Fuente del Berro, with its renovated terraces and the iconic «Casita del Reloj.» Additionally, improvements will be made to the park’s accessibility, signage, furniture, lighting, and security.

A park with roots in the 17th century

This green space in the capital, spanning 79,000 m², has its origins in the 17th century when the slopes of the Abroñigal stream – now covered by the M-30 highway – housed orchards and vineyards. Acquired by the municipality in 1948, it has become a place for leisure and relaxation for the residents of the Salamanca district, and efforts are now underway to enhance its ecological and heritage value.

Transformations for a more accessible and sustainable park

With over 500 years of history, the Quinta de la Fuente del Berro blends nature and history in a unique setting. The master plan launched by the City Council to revitalize the park over the next 10 years (2025-2035) includes the following improvements:

– Restoration of the Rafael Altamira Cultural Center – Fuente del Berro, with its renovated terraces and the iconic «Casita del Reloj.» Additionally, improvements will be made to accessibility, signage, furniture, lighting, and security, making the park an even more welcoming place for walks, reading, and moments of calm.

– Accessibility and security: New entrances, clear signage, modern lighting, and renovated furniture.

– Water conservation: Analysis of hydraulic systems and hydrogeological solutions for a more sustainable park.

– Lake expansion: Possible addition of a bridge and jetty that evoke its historical past.

– A notable aspect is the preservation of the «water journey» through the Fountain of Health, an iconic element that will be at the forefront of the renovations.

– The western and northern enclosure walls, part of its rich architectural heritage, will also be restored to keep alive the essence of this Cultural Heritage site (BIC).

Ecological and historical innovation on the horizon

The project looks not only to the past but also to the future. All hydraulic elements of the park will be analyzed and optimized, creating catalogs of hydrogeological solutions to ensure sustainability. Among the proposals is the potential expansion of the lake, with the addition of a bridge and jetty that recall historical images of the park, a nod to its legacy captured in old photographs.

Declared of high ecological value and key to urban health in the Salamanca district, the Quinta de la Fuente del Berro Park will establish itself as a reference space in Madrid. This master plan, part of a broader initiative that includes the Buen Retiro Gardens and the Juan Pablo II Park, aims to unify intervention criteria and optimize resources over the next ten years.
